Question about unlocking DB2020 with old firmware

Is there any risk trying to unlock a DB2020 phone with old firmware? Or will it always give error BEFORE anything is done to the phone, and credits deducted?

If it has old firmware - how should i upgrade it? Using SEUS? Or do i need to spend more credits in UB to flash it first?

Since DC2020 unlocking is quite new we are looking for ways to improve it. As we did already by offering to skip the first part if it is already done. Unlocking DC2020 can be 100 credits for those who has firmware >= R1ED001 but can be 103 to those who doesn't have recent firmware version. But firmware upgrade is an independent thing and it did exist before DB2020 unlock. We are not cheating customers with any credits by any way. This firmware thing is not depends on us. Older firmwares simply does not supports CSCA activation and needs to be upgraded.
